  2. Jun 21, 2024 · Jake Name Meaning. The name Jake means “supplanter” or “one who follows.”. This reflects the biblical story of Jacob, who was born after his twin brother Esau and was later given the birthright that was meant for Esau.

  3. Sep 30, 2024 · The name Jake is a boy's name of Hebrew origin meaning "supplanter". This unpretentious, accessible, and optimistic ("everything's jake" -- meaning OK) short form of the top name Jacob is itself widely used, though more parents these days are opting for the full name Jacob.
